C3 CNV is a 2019 BMW 118 in Grey with a 1,499c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 6 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2019 BMW 118 models, the average MOT pass rate is 87.8% with a typical mileage of 32,657 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 118 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 33,763 recorded failures. If you're considering buying C3 CNV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 118 typ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 7 years old, this BMW 118 is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
